Crewe is a town in Nottoway County, Virginia, United States. The population was 2,378 at the 2000 census. The town was founded in 1888 as a central location to house locomotive repair shops for the Norfolk and Western Railway (now called Norfolk Southern) which has a rail yard there for east-west trains carrying Appalachian coal to the coast for export abroad. There is a small railroad museum. Lottie Moon, a noted Baptist missionary to China, is buried in the town cemetery. The last American Civil War engagement before the official surrender, occurred at nearby Saylor's Creek. The regional electric cooperative and the Piedmont geriatric hospital are near Crewe.
